Recognizing the Need
Before exploring the replacement of cavity wall insulation, it's crucial to first acknowledge when it's vital to do so. For me, it was when I noticed my energy bills were steadily climbing, despite my efforts to be more energy-efficient. It was a clear sign something wasn't right. On colder days, certain rooms felt noticeably chillier, and there were damp patches on the walls that seemed to have appeared out of nowhere. These were red flags I couldn't overlook.
I started conducting some research and learned that these signs often indicate failing cavity wall insulation. Insulation that's deteriorated or wasn't properly installed in the first place can result in heat loss, higher energy costs, and moisture problems. I realized it wasn't just about comfort; it was also impacting my home's energy efficiency and potentially its structural integrity.
Deciding to investigate further, I contacted a professional to evaluate the situation. They confirmed my suspicions, explaining how compromised insulation could lead to the issues I was experiencing. It was then I knew, replacing my cavity wall insulation wasn't just an option; it was a necessity for the well-being of my home and my peace of mind.

The Replacement Process
I'll guide you through the essential steps involved in replacing cavity wall insulation to make sure your home stays energy-efficient and comfortable. After deciding to initiate my cavity wall insulation replacement, I embarked on a journey that was both enlightening and rewarding. Here's how it unfolded:
Choosing the Right Material: I started by researching the most suitable insulation material for my home. Considering factors like thermal performance, moisture resistance, and environmental impact, I opted for a high-quality, sustainable option that promised longevity and efficiency.
Finding a Qualified Installer: Next, I searched for a certified installer with a pivotal reputation. It was essential to find someone experienced and knowledgeable, who could not only do the job well but also provide valuable insights and advice. After some digging and comparing, I found the perfect team for the task.
The Installation: The actual replacement process was smoother than I anticipated. The team arrived on time, explained the process step by step, and took great care to minimize disruption. They drilled small holes in the external walls, removed the old insulation, and then meticulously injected the new material, ensuring every cavity was filled.
